Scouting the Other Side:
State's HC: Zach Arnett. Leach's DC at Miss. State before his passing and became interim HC for their bowl game against Illinois. He played football at New Mexico and previously was the DC at SDSU.
State's OC: Kevin Barbay. Formerly the App State OC - known for putting video game numbers on UNC's defense.
State's DC: Matt Brock. Formerly the LB coach at State before getting promoted to DC by Zach Arnett. He also was the OLB and Strength coach for Wash. State during Leach's tenure there.
